I've just checked and it works over here, if I'm currently in the queue.
Command tried SONOS_HOST=192.168.20.23 node examples/playSpotifyMusic.js

If I play TuneIn and clear the queue, I'm getting a different error.

Error occurred {"message":"Request failed with status code 500","name":"Error","stack":"Error: Request failed with status code 500\n    at createError (/Users/stephan/Projects/node-sonos/node_modules/axios/lib/core/createError.js:16:15)\n    at settle (/Users/stephan/Projects/node-sonos/node_modules/axios/lib/core/settle.js:17:12)\n    at IncomingMessage.handleStreamEnd (/Users/stephan/Projects/node-sonos/node_modules/axios/lib/adapters/http.js:237:11)\n    at IncomingMessage.emit (events.js:228:7)\n    at endReadableNT (_stream_readable.js:1185:12)\n    at processTicksAndRejections (internal/process/task_queues.js:81:21)","config":{"url":"http://192.168.20.23:1400/MediaRenderer/AVTransport/Control","method":"post","data":"<s:Envelope xmlns:s=\"http://schemas.xmlsoap.org/soap/envelope/\" s:encodingStyle=\"http://schemas.xmlsoap.org/soap/encoding/\"><s:Body><u:Seek xmlns:u=\"urn:schemas-upnp-org:service:AVTransport:1\"><InstanceID>0</InstanceID><Unit>TRACK_NR</Unit><Target>1</Target></u:Seek></s:Body></s:Envelope>","headers":{"Accept":"application/json, text/plain, */*","Content-Type":"text/xml; charset=utf8","SOAPAction":"\"urn:schemas-upnp-org:service:AVTransport:1#Seek\"","User-Agent":"axios/0.19.0","Content-Length":289},"transformRequest":[null],"transformResponse":[null],"timeout":0,"xsrfCookieName":"XSRF-TOKEN","xsrfHeaderName":"X-XSRF-TOKEN","maxContentLength":-1}}

I've solved it by changing these lines to:

      .then(async result => {
        await this.selectQueue()
        return this.selectTrack(result.FirstTrackNumberEnqueued)
      })

Can you @irdeto-hackwestern check if that solves the issue? @bencevans do you see any problems with this solution?

Apart from this issue

Node Version 9.6.1 is almost 2 years old, and wasn't a LTS version. node-sonos is tested against version 8, 10 and the latest LTS. So my first suggestion is to update your node version.
